5th Annual Juvenile Sex Offender Management Conference

Topics Covered:

  • Juvenile Integrated Treatment Court
  • Partnering with Polygraph
  • Promising Practices in Responding to Juvenile Victims
  • Adolescent Females with Sexual Behavior Problems
  • Living with the Memories
  • A Multidisciplinary Approach to Managing High Risk Youth in the Community
  • Cyber Safety for Parents
  • Monitoring Computer Usage for High Risk Populations
  • New Treatment Programs for TYC
  • Panel: The Determinate Sentence Probation Option with Sex Offenders
  • Sex Offender Management in Bexar County
  • Providing Supervision to New Juvenile Sex Offender Therapists
